Resume Writing

WHAT IS A RESUME?

A resume is a summary of your education, experience, achievements and interests

relevant to the position you are pursuing.

Your resume is, in many instances, the first opportunity a prospective employer has to

discover who you are and how you may be a valuable contributor to the organization. In

some cases, it is the only chance you have. Therefore, it is essential that your resume a

strong impression during the competitive search for the most suitable candidate. You must

customize it to the readers' interest to keep them captivated.

All job seekers must have a good resume.

It opens doors.

It also:

Organizes your own thinking about your career by linking what you have done to what you

want to do

Helps you express yourself more consistently and effectively during meetings and

interviews.

Serves as a useful guide for interviewers, helping them view your background in the ways

you want to be seen.

Proves to be a tangible document to leave behind after a meeting or to attach to any

follow-up letters.

Resume Quick Tips

Make your name stand out with Bold Text, Underl i ning , or ALL CAPITAL LEITERS, and be sure to

make the font size 12+

Keep your resume clear (adequate white space) and easy-to-read with one or two different font

styles and sizes

Explain why you should be hired for the position?

Use action verbs in the description of your jobs and activities

Reference List should be handed in during the interview

Always list your phone numbers and addresses ... ALWAYS

Customize your resume style to the company and position you want

Types of Resumes

There are three primary types of resumes; the chronological resume, the functional resume,

and the combination resume. Each of these types also has variations.

Which type of resume you create depends on how much experience you have in the industry

and in occupation you want to work in.

Chronological resumes:

A chronological resume typically lists each job you have held in

order, beginning with the most recent (please refer to page 5).

Functional resumes

: The functional resume lets you highlight these strengths and downplay

your lack of industry experience (please refer to page 6 and 7).

If covering your years of experience in a chronological resume would require more than two

pages, or if the description of your responsibility in several jobs would be repeating the same

information, a functional resume gives you more latitude in how to organize information.

Combination

resumes

: Combines the best qualities of the chronological and functional

resume (Please refer to page 8). Your work history is presented in chronological order, but it

may come after a review of your functional skills and your achievements.

APPLYING FOR JOBS ONLINE

Many employers now use online job boards

,

e-mail and resume

scanners to find the best candidates.

To apply for online jobs, you may need to create and use an

electronic resume

.

CREATING AN ELECTRONIC RESUME

 An electronic resume is also called an e-resume or digital resumes

 In creating your electronic resume, you are taking information on your resume and adapting it to the various types of formats used online

 Your e-resume should be in Plain Text version (also called Text-Only) which allows you to

insert your resume into an e-mail, or to cut and paste it into an online application system

 An e-resume uses simple formatting, omitting such features as bullets, underlining, and italics

THE "KEY" TO USING THE RIGHT WORDS

You may be perfect for the job but without the right words, your resume may end up in cyberspace forever!

 Many companies who receive large numbers of electronic resumes use software that look for relevant keywords

 There is no set list of keywords. The keywords vary among employers from job to job.

 The keywords selected by the employer are related to the skills and qualifications required for the job

 The search engine scans all resumes for the keyword and selects those resumes that meet the requirements

 If you lack some of the keywords, you resume may not be considered at all

Steps to Using Keywords in Your Resume

1. Look at the job ad and determine the main experience, skills and qualifications required. These are often the "hot" keywords employers look for.

2. Include "hot" keywords right at the top of your cover letter or at the beginning of your resume - use the job title and focus on your job-related skills.
